A pilot’s “ostentatious display” — a high-speed fly-by followed by a steep climb — caused the February 2010 crash of a Cessna 337 that killed five people in New Jersey, two of them children, a federal report charged yesterday.

In the wake of the accident, the FAA issued a safety order directing Cessna owners to inspect wings for damage and to put placards listing operational limits in their cockpits.
